Trump Targets Blue Cities with Expanded Deportation Blitz Amid Nationwide Protests
Adobe Stock/ungvar/stock.adobe.com

President Trump is doubling down on immigration enforcement, directing ICE to ramp up deportations in Democratic-run cities like Los Angeles, New York, and Chicago. The move follows waves of protests across the country and marks a sharp escalation in his push for what he calls the “largest Mass Deportation Program in History.” While enforcement efforts in key industries like agriculture and hospitality are being scaled back, arrests in urban centers are expected to surge, with a new target of 3,000 daily. As protests continue and cities brace for impact, Trump remains defiant, insisting his policies are necessary to restore order and uphold immigration laws.
